Noun [Tagalog]

IPA: /ʔiˈtoj/ [Standard-Tagalog], [ʔɪˈt̪oɪ̯] [Standard-Tagalog] Forms: itóy [canonical], ᜁᜆᜓᜌ᜔ [Baybayin]
Rhymes: -oj Head templates: {{tl-noun|itóy|b=+}} itóy (Baybayin spelling ᜁᜆᜓᜌ᜔)
  1. term of address for a young boy Synonyms: totoy, toto, amang, ato, utoy, anak
